Chapter 4 Electrical Wiring
Hollow Cable (Between the Probe and Junction Box)
Use the special cable in the hollow pipe (hollow cable) connected at the time of shipment
for wiring. Do not use any other wire or cable. Additionally, since the wiring of this section
was done at the factory, please use it as it is.
Grounding
Grounding is very important to prevent the device from being damaged by induced light-
ning surge. Be sure to do the grounding work.

Ground the device with a resistance of less than 100 Ω. In a location where large
induced lightning surge can be expected or frequently occurs, use more advanced
grounding. This will ensure the sufficient performance of the built-in lighting arrestor.
y
Use 600 V PVC-insulated wires for grounding.
y
Probe
The probe does not need to be individually grounded because grounding the junction box
grounds the probe.
y
Junction box
y
Be sure to ground the junction box, since doing so effectively grounds the probe.
y
Ground terminals are located both on the inside (GND part of the terminal plate) and
outside (case) of the junction box. Either terminal can be used.
Power Supply and External Load Resistance
It is necessary to determine the relationship between the power voltage and external load
resistance used for this device within the range shown in the figure below. The external
load resistance is the sum total of the resistance values connected to the output terminals
of this device, such as the resistance of the cables that make up the loop and the internal
resistance of connected gauges.
